**Action Item 4: Restore snapshot coverage for Lattice UI components**

During the incident, a regression in the Lattice date-picker shipped undetected because snapshot tests had been disabled after a flaky-baseline cleanup. We will re-enable snapshots with deterministic rendering (fixed locale, frozen clock, seeded random) and require baseline updates to be reviewed separately from feature changes. The full policy, including exemption criteria, is maintained on the internal page.

runbook for tafof-yawif: https://confluence.tolvaqsys.internal/display/display/browse/pages/7be3

### Changed defaults: bounce processor

The Mistrelay bounce processor now treats soft bounces as retryable for 72 hours instead of dropping them after three attempts, and hard bounces suppress the recipient immediately rather than after a second failure. Reviewers should check downstream suppression-list consumers. The new defaults shipped in this release are as follows.

service settings:
novath:
  pin: 1396
  tenant: pelys
  seal: seal_ccc035e1
  metrics_host: metrics.novath.qorvelworks.test
  standby_team: fraeth
  escalation: drueth-zorok
  nonce: 61d508

Runbook 7.3 — Account Recovery (Partitioned Tables)

For the release manager at Quillbrook Software: the Accountvault store is partitioned by month, so recovery must target the correct monthly partition before replaying events. Confirm the partition boundary in the manifest, detach the affected month, and restore from the most recent snapshot only. Once the partition is reattached, the recovery shell will request the operator passphrase, which is recorded below.

strongbox words: alddor-rusius-belox-gorys-holius-oliix-ralmir-lamvan-briius-fraion-zormir-novwyn-zormir-holmir

## TICKET-4182: Connection failures during GC pauses

The Pairline matching service drops database connections whenever a full garbage-collection pause exceeds the idle timeout. The pool then reconnects in a burst, briefly exhausting server slots. Please reproduce locally by lowering the heap ceiling and watching pool logs carefully. To reproduce against the staging database, connect with the string below.

database URL for haduf-tajof: redis://holox_svc:c9@db-3fb6.lumicworks.local:5432/fraeth